Contents
  1. Cassette 1. Lake of fire (1976) (ca. 27 min.) / choreography, Don Redlich ; music, Felix Mendelssohn, arranged ; costumes, Sally Ann Parsons, Jim Meares ; danced by the Don Redlich Dance Company: Irene Feigenheimer (woman in white), Robyn Cutler (woman in blue), Kathryn Appleby (woman in purple), Jim Clinton (man in brown), Don Redlich (man in black).
  2. Dance to Igor Stravinsky's piano sonata (1924) ([dance premiere] 1982) (ca. 11 min.) / choreography, Annabelle Gamson ; music, Igor Stravinsky ; costume, Don Mangone ; danced by Risa Steinberg ; pianist, Robert Cornman.
  3. Lumen (premiere) (ca. 12 min.) / choreography, Annabelle Gamson in collaboration with lighting designer Richard Nelson ; music, Ruth Cranford Seeger ; danced by Annabelle Gamson ; music played by the Composers String Quartet: Matthew Raimondi (violin), Anahid Ajemian (violin), Jean Dane (viola), Mark Shuman (cello).
  4. Cassette 2. Harold II (premiere) (ca. 11 min.) / choreography and performance, Don Redlich ; music, arranged ; costume, Sally Ann Parsons.
  5. For spirits and kings (premiere) (ca. 26 min.) / choreography, Phyllis Lamhut ; music, Robert Moran ; costumes, Martha Yoshida ; guest artists (dancers), Irene Feigenheimer, Phyllis Lamhut, Robert Small, Gael Stepanek, Vic Stornant ; harp ensemble, Mario Falcao (conductor), Amy Berger, Carol Emanuel, Elizabeth Etters, Alyssa Hess, Wendy Kerner, Sarah Kaleolani Voynow, Catherine White.
